A financial services company in Watford seeks a Credit Controller to manage customer accounts effectively. Responsibilities include reviewing aged debt reports, liaising with customers and the sales team, and preparing legal forms when necessary.

Ideal candidates possess strong communication skills, relevant experience in finance, and familiarity with tools like Excel and SAP. The role offers a salary of £28-30k, appealing to those committed to achieving results in a team-oriented environ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Van Ierland Assurantiën

Know Your Numbers

Brush up on your financial knowledge, especially around aged debt reports and collections. Be ready to discuss how you've managed customer accounts in the past and any specific tools you've used, like Excel or SAP.

Communicate Clearly

Since strong communication skills are key for this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ly. Think about examples where you successfully liaised with customers or worked with a sales team to resolve issues.

Prepare for Legal Questions

Familiarise yourself with the legal forms and processes related to debt collection. Be prepared to explain how you would handle situations that require legal action, showcasing your understanding of compliance and best practices.

Show Team Spirit

This role is all about teamwork, so come ready to discuss how you’ve contributed to a team environment in previous roles. Share specific examples of how you’ve collaborated with others to achieve results,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.
